Augustana College's Maripaz Ramirez achieved a notable victory for her team in their 4-3 dual win against Loras, earning her the Women's Tennis Student-Athlete of the Week recognition from the College Conference of Illinois & Wisconsin (CCIW). Ramirez, a freshman from Belen, Costa Rica, partnered with Natasha Gauerke, securing a doubles win by defeating Ellie Kalina and Leia Papanicholas with a 6-4 score in the second doubles slot. She also triumphed in the #2 singles match against Dorothy Deans, winning 6-3, 7-5.

The CCIW announced its weekly honorees for the 2024-25 Women's Tennis Student-Athlete awards. On April 22, the recognition was given to Maripaz Ramirez from Augustana. Previous weeks saw accolades awarded to Madeline Gentry from Wheaton on April 15, Abigail Penados from North Central on April 8 and March 4, Kaitlyn Mullins from Millikin on March 25, Natasa Pupovac from Carroll on March 18, Hannah Colbert from Augustana on February 26 and September 18, Alexandra Ristfeldt from North Park on October 16, Ella Malone from Wheaton on October 9, Xingchen Liu from Carthage on September 25, Emily Markus from Millikin on September 11, and Delaney Canning from Wheaton on September 4.
